The humidity response law in concrete in the natural environment

Based on the saturation vapor pressure equation,the relation between the relative humidity and the water vapor density was investigated.The humidity change laws of the natural environment and the concrete were also studied.By analyzing the humidity change law,the natural environment humidity action spectrum and the concrete humidity response spectrum models were deduced.The results show that the natural environment humidity action spectrum and the concrete humidity response spectrum models can be used to describe the humidity change law.With the time,the relative humidity curve of the natural environment displays as cyclical fluctuation.Conversely,the relative humidity in concrete displays as linear change.Comparing with the relative humidity,the water vapor density can be wonderfully used to describe the humidity change under different condition.
